Eton Pharmaceuticals (ETON) Asset Utilization Ratio: 2020-2024
Historic Asset Utilization Ratio for Eton Pharmaceuticals (ETON) over the last 5 years, with Dec 2024 value amounting to 0.72.
- Eton Pharmaceuticals' Asset Utilization Ratio fell 68.53% to 0.53 in Q3 2025 from the same period last year, while for Sep 2025 it was 0.53, marking a year-over-year decrease of 68.53%. This contributed to the annual value of 0.72 for FY2024, which is 35.11% down from last year.
- Eton Pharmaceuticals' Asset Utilization Ratio amounted to 0.72 in FY2024, which was down 35.11% from 1.11 recorded in FY2023.
- In the past 5 years, Eton Pharmaceuticals' Asset Utilization Ratio registered a high of 1.11 during FY2023, and its lowest value of 0.00 during FY2020.
- Over the past 3 years, Eton Pharmaceuticals' median Asset Utilization Ratio value was 0.81 (recorded in 2022), while the average stood at 0.88.
- Per our database at Business Quant, Eton Pharmaceuticals' Asset Utilization Ratio surged by 45,062.24% in 2021 and then slumped by 35.11% in 2024.
- Yearly analysis of 5 years shows Eton Pharmaceuticals' Asset Utilization Ratio stood at 0.00 in 2020, then soared by 45,062.24% to 0.81 in 2021, then dropped by 0.27% to 0.81 in 2022, then soared by 37.68% to 1.11 in 2023, then crashed by 35.11% to 0.72 in 2024.
